The industry is moving away from time-based visits to condition-based maintenance. Traditional alarms only alert technicians after damage occurs, whereas AI monitors subtle patterns in:

  • pH and chlorine levels
  • Pump and filter efficiency
  • Energy consumption anomalies

ArionERP reports that AI can provide 1-3 weeks of advance warning for maintenance issues, reducing costs by 40%. This shift is driven by IoT sensors that provide real-time data, allowing AI to trigger work orders only when necessary.

Traditional pool maintenance relies on scheduled visits or reactive fixes after a problem occurs. AI flips this model by analyzing real-time data from IoT sensors (pH, chlorine levels, pump pressure) to predict failures 1-3 weeks in advance—before they become emergencies.

Key benefits: - 93% accuracy in detecting maintenance issues early (according to Oxmaint’s research) - 85% fewer emergency closures due to predictive alerts - 4-5x cheaper repairs when caught early vs. emergency fixes

Example: A pool service company using AI monitoring detected a failing pump motor two weeks before failure, allowing a scheduled repair instead of an emergency call.

AI doesn’t just predict issues—it automates the response. When a sensor detects an imbalance or potential failure, the system: - Generates a smart work order with diagnostics - Schedules the technician at the optimal time (avoiding peak hours) - Updates the customer automatically via SMS or email

Result: A 20% increase in daily service stops due to optimized routing and fewer unnecessary visits.

Will AI actually replace human technicians in pool maintenance?
No, AI isn't replacing technicians but making their jobs more efficient. As noted by Pool Magazine's Joe Trusty, AI helps diagnose issues more precisely (like identifying pump failures as capacitor vs. impeller problems), reducing unnecessary service calls and making technicians more effective.
